Capability
public enum Capability : SwiftProtobuf.Enum
extension Google_Jacquard_Protocol_Public_Sdk_GearMetadata.Capability: CaseIterable
extension Google_Jacquard_Protocol_Public_Sdk_GearMetadata.Capability: SwiftProtobuf._ProtoNameProviding
Gear capabilitiy options.
-
Declaration
Swift
public typealias RawValue = Int
-
This gear can be used for
PlayLEDPatternCommand
.Declaration
Swift
case led
-
This gear supports gestures. i.e
TouchMode.gesture
Declaration
Swift
case gesture
-
This gear supports touch data stream. i.e
TouchMode.touchDataStream
Declaration
Swift
case touchDataStream
-
This gear can be used for
PlayHapticCommand
.Declaration
Swift
case haptic
-
Unknown capability.
Declaration
Swift
case UNRECOGNIZED(Int)
-
Declaration
Swift
public init()
-
Declaration
Swift
public init?(rawValue: Int)
-
Declaration
Swift
public var rawValue: Int { get }
-
Declaration
Swift
public static var allCases: [Google_Jacquard_Protocol_Public_Sdk_GearMetadata.Capability]
-
Declaration
Swift
public static let _protobuf_nameMap: SwiftProtobuf._NameMap